Item 3. Source and Amount of Funds or Other Consideration.

Item 3 is hereby amended and restated in its entirety as follows:

The Issuer was formed on February 6, 2013 as a Delaware limited partnership to conduct any business activity that is approved by Tallgrass MLP GP, LLC, a Delaware limited liability company and the general partner of the Issuer (the “General Partner”), and that lawfully may be conducted by a limited partnership organized under Delaware law. The General Partner has no current plans to cause the Issuer to engage in activities other than the ownership and operation of midstream energy assets. Upon the formation of the Issuer, Tallgrass Operations, as the organizational limited partner, and the General Partner contributed $980 and $20, respectively, to the Issuer.

At the closing of the Issuer’s initial public offering on May 17, 2013 (the “Offering”) the following transaction, among others, occurred: The Issuer issued to Tallgrass Operations 9,292,500 Common Units and 16,200,000 Subordinated Units, representing an aggregate 62.3% partnership interest in the Issuer (based on the aggregate number of Common Units, Subordinated Units and General Partner Units of the Issuer outstanding as of May 17, 2013) as of such time pursuant to a Contribution, Conveyance and Assumption Agreement, dated May 17, 2013, by and among the Issuer, the General Partner, Tallgrass Development, Tallgrass Development GP, Tallgrass GP Holdings, Tallgrass Operations, Tallgrass Interstate Gas Transmission, LLC, a Colorado limited liability company, Tallgrass Midstream, LLC, a Delaware limited liability company and Tallgrass MLP Operations, LLC, a Delaware limited liability company.

Upon the termination of the subordination period as set forth in the Issuer’s Amended & Restated Agreement of Limited Partnership (the “Partnership Agreement”), the subordinated units are convertible into Common units on a one-for-one basis.

On May 17, 2013, certain Covered Individuals acquired with personal funds beneficial ownership of Common Units through the Issuer’s directed unit program at the initial public offering price of $21.50 per unit, as set forth in Item 5(a).


In connection with the Offering, pursuant to that certain Underwriting Agreement, dated May 13, 2013 (the “Underwriting Agreement”), by and among Barclays Capital Inc. and Citigroup Global Markets Inc., as representatives of the underwriters named therein (the “Underwriters”), and Tallgrass Development, the General Partner and the Issuer, the Issuer granted to the Underwriters an option to purchase up to 1,957,500 Common Units, in addition to the Common Units sold in the Offering, for a period of 30 days after the date of the Underwriting Agreement (the “Over-Allotment Option”). The Underwriters partially exercised the Over-Allotment Option with respect to 1,550,000 Common Units on May 17, 2013. The Over-Allotment Option expired on June 12, 2013, and the remaining 407,500 Common Units were issued to Tallgrass Operations pursuant to the terms of the Underwriting Agreement.
